Amundi increased its stake in shares of Tetra Tech, Inc. (NASDAQ:TTEK – Free Report) by 2.5%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 4,873,176 shares of the industrial products company’s stock after buying an additional 117,304 shares during the quarter. Amundi owned 1.82% of Tetra Tech worth $194,314,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Tetra Tech Price Performance
NASDAQ TTEK opened at $30.02 on Monday. The company has a market cap of $8.05 billion, a PE ratio of 31.53 and a beta of 0.93. The company has a quick ratio of 1.29, a current ratio of 1.29 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.53. The firm’s 50-day simple moving average is $35.52 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$42.03. Tetra Tech, Inc. has a 52 week low of $28.17 and a 52 week high of $51.20.
Tetra Tech (NASDAQ:TTEK –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, January 29th. The industrial products company reported $0.35 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.34 by $0.01. Tetra Tech had a net margin of 4.81% and a return on equity of 22.58%. Research analysts predict that Tetra Tech, Inc. will post 1.37 earnings per share for the current year.

About Tetra Tech
Tetra Tech, Inc provides consulting and engineering services in the United States and internationally. The company operates through two segments, Government Services Group (GSG) and Commercial/International Services Group (CIG). The GSG segment offers early data collection and monitoring, data analysis and information management, science and engineering applied research, engineering design, project management, and operations and maintenance services; and climate change and energy management consulting, as well as greenhouse gas inventory assessment, certification, reduction, and management services.
